Yeah, I have the Neve bundle, of which the 88 is a part. Of the neves. though, I've used the 1073 the most -- on vocals bus and on the master output. I also swear by the Pultecs to get that heavy John Bonham sort of drum sound, which is essential for one sort of music I do. Also on the master out I use the LA-2 limiter and the precision buss compressor. I like the fairchild compressor for drums on less aggressive songs.

iMacs, like Macbooks are considered "consumer" machines. Mac Pros and Macbook Pro's are machines designed more for the working professional, or serious amateurs, and hence they have considerably more expansion potential and features.

UAD cards are not the kinds of things that average consumers buy, they are professional items. And not only that, they don't make a FW UAD card for a number of reasons, and as FW is the only way you can add things to an iMac (apart from USB), then if you want to be able to use these things, an iMac is not the best choice of machine.

HI Folks,

there is a way 🙂
- Just get any PC or mac with PCI slot
- Install the UAD plugg
- plugg your uad card in the machine
-Install Wormhole2 ( http://plasq.com/wormhole) in your imac
- run Logic etc... you'll see Wormhole
- Whormhole will help you to find on the PCi machine the uad plugg
- select your best plugg (max 3 or 4)
- enjoy using UAD power within you imac
Only one thing! It couldn't synchronised pluggs over 44 or 48 khtz
So don't work over 48 khtz for any project you want to use the UAD pluggs!

it is not so professional... and max 3 or 4 pluggs (Uad plugins require great bandwidth ... only one Neve Compressor require about 30% of uad-1 DSP!!
... are not sufficient for a mastering section...
The latency should be toomuch Ethernet Latency + UAD DSP latency.

The uad plugs must be run on the machine where UAD-1 (or 2) card has been installed in the PCI slot...

So, the better way should be to use the PC (in order to use fully UAD DSP power processing) ... and not the iMac!

UAD-1 or 2 cannot run on iMacs in any case.

BUT: there is a way... Logic Audio Unit menager allow to use UAD plugs as Logic NODE... but you must use a Mac (also a G4) with PCI slot as Main Machine.

I never test that... is like a little mystery, but UAD-plugins pass AU validation also for Logic NODE function.
